With excerpts from Smetana’s Má vlast and Dvořák’s Moravian Duets, the Concertgebouw Orchestra undertakes a fascinating Bohemian journey. In addition, Iván Fischer leads Braunstein's Beatles adaptation, Abbey Road Concerto, and stirring music from Bernstein's musical On the Town.
Iván Fischer and Guy Braunstein
Honorary guest conductor Iván Fischer is once again conducting the Concertgebouw Orchestra in a unique and festive programme. The evening has two faces, one featuring the American-Jewish artists Bernstein and Braunstein before the interval, and afterwards, the Bohemian composers Dvořák and Smetana, who take us on a fascinating journey through their homeland. Leonard Bernstein’s sparkling dances from On the Town serve as a prelude to the Abbey Road Concerto which features composer-violinist Guy Braunstein (formerly leader of the Berlin Philharmonic Orchestra) as soloist in his own work. Familiar melodies from the Beatles’ iconic album are interwoven with Braunstein’s own music.
Smetana and Dvořák
After the interval, Iván Fischer pairs excerpts from Smetana’s Má vlast (My Fatherland) with some of Dvořák’s Moravian Duets, sung by Mirella Hagen and Olivia Vermeulen. This melodious music paints a vivid, colourful picture of Bohemia in all its facets. Bohemian landscapes, scenes from the lives of Moravian peasant children and a mythical battle are all depicted in music, concluding with Smetana’s most famous river melody, The Moldau.
